Lionel Bowen Park is a well-regarded dog-friendly park in Mascot. You'll find shaded space, drinking water, BBQs, and toilets nearby, while The PAWFECT Cafe Mascot is around 650 metres away for an easy post-walk coffee.
Dogs are permitted on leash under Bayside Council’s dog policy. Dogs must be on a lead unless they are inside a designated off-leash area. Dogs are prohibited within 10 metres of children’s play equipment and food preparation or eating facilities, except where the food area is on a public thoroughfare such as a road, footpath or pathway.

An absolutely fantastic inner city park. Has grass area. Big sand pit with water play area. Big choo-choo train on springs. A rock to climb on! Swings of various sorts. And a variety of other things to keep the kids entertained. Plus BBQ and sheltered area. Not fenced.
